Original Description
Joaquín Sorolla’s Galicia (1910) is a luminous ode to the rugged beauty of Spain’s northwestern coast, bathed in his signature style of Luminismo. Capturing a windswept cliffs, crashing waves, and figures in traditional dress, the painting thrums with movement and light, as if the sea breeze could ripple off the canvas. Sorolla’s loose, impressionistic brushwork and mastery of natural light—pearl-gray skies dissolving into sunlit foam—elevate the scene beyond mere realism into a poetic celebration of regional identity. Created during his Vision of Spain series (commissioned for New York’s Hispanic Society), this work exemplifies his role as Spain’s premier plein-air painter, bridging Impressionism and Spanish tradition. Art historically, Galicia marks Sorolla’s late-career shift toward monumental landscapes, cementing his legacy as a master of light and cultural narrative.
